The unemployment rate in Eleele, HI, is 8.50%, with job growth of 0.89%.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 33.28%.

Eleele, HI Taxes

Eleele, HI,sales tax rate is 4.00%. Income tax is 8.25%.

Eleele, HI Income and Salaries

The income per capita is $24,472, which includes all adults and children. The median household income is $66,062.
